#044511 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#044511 is composed of 1.6% red, 27.1%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.4% yellow and 72.9% black. It has a hue angle of 132 degrees, a saturation of 89% and a lightness of 14.3%. #044511 color hex could be obtained by blending #088a22 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

● #044511 color description : Very dark lime green.
#044511 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#044511 has RGB values of R:4, G:69, B:17 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 279825.

Shades and Tints of #044511
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d03 is the darkest color, while #fafff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#044511
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#232624 is the less saturated color, while #01480f is the most saturated one.
